"The American Plan" is a play by Richard Greenberg. It was first produced and performed by Manhattan Theatre Club [cite news |first=Frank |last=Rich |title=Review/Theater; Lost in the Crosscurrents of Mainstream America |url=http://query.nytimes.com/gst/fullpage.html?res=9C0CE2DF1231F934A25751C1A966958260 |work=The New York Times |date=1990-12-17 ] Stage II on January 23, 1990, in New York City. The original cast included Rebecca Miller, Tate Donovan, Beatrice Winde, Joan Copeland, and Eric Stoltz.
